OPB850-1 Equivalent & Substitute Parts
Part Overview
The OPB850-1 is an optical sensor designed for optical flag detection applications. It features a transistor output configuration with integrated base-emitter resistor module and pre-wired assembly. The component operates as an unamplified optical sensor with snap-in mounting capability.
The OPB850-1 is classified as obsolete. Locating direct replacements from current inventory requires evaluation of functionally equivalent alternatives that maintain electrical and mechanical compatibility with the original design specifications.

Key Parameters
| Parameter | Value |
|---|---|
| Manufacturer | TT Electronics/Optek Technology |
| Category | Optical Sensors |
| Sensing Method | Optical Flag |
| Output Configuration | Transistor, Base-Emitter Resistor |
| Current - DC Forward (If) (Max) | 50 mA |
| Current - Collector (Ic) (Max) | 20 mA |
| Voltage - Collector Emitter Breakdown (Max) | 24 V |
| Operating Temperature Range | -20°C ~ 75°C |
| Mounting Type | Snap-In |
| Package / Case | Module, Pre-Wired |
| Type | Unamplified |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|

Engineering Selection Recommendations
The OPB850-1Z is the direct equivalent for the obsolete OPB850-1. Both components share identical electrical and mechanical specifications across all critical parameters: sensing method, output configuration, current ratings, voltage ratings, operating temperature range, mounting type, and package configuration.
The primary distinction is product status and regulatory compliance. The OPB850-1Z is currently in active production status, whereas the OPB850-1 is obsolete. The OPB850-1Z achieves ROHS3 compliance, whereas the original OPB850-1 is RoHS non-compliant. Both maintain identical REACH and ECCN classifications.
For new designs or component replacement in existing applications, the OPB850-1Z provides functional and electrical equivalence with the advantage of current availability and improved regulatory compliance.
